Procedure

Pivaloyloxymethyl bromide (0.10 g, ca. 0.5 mmol) and sodium iodide (0.1 g) in acetone (1 ml) were stirred for 0.25 h, filtered and evaporated in vacuo. The iodide in toluene (0.5 ml) was added to sodium (6R,7R)-7-[2(2-aminothiazol-4-yl)-2-(Z)-methoxyiminoacetamido]-3-[(5RS)-2-oxotetrahydrofuran-5-yl]ceph-3-em-4-carboxylate (0.124 g, 0.25 mmol) in N-methylpyrrolidone (2 ml) and stirred for 0.5 h. The reaction mixture was diluted with ethyl acetate, washed twice with water, and with brine, dried, concentrated and flash chromatographed on silica gel eluting with 80,90,100% ethyl acetate in hexane to give the title compound (86 mg, 59%), νmax (CH2Cl2) 1780, 1753, 1735, 1682, 1532, 1374, 1121, 1046 cm-1 ; δH (250 MHz, CDCl3) (9H, s), 1.9-2.2 (1H, m), 2.4-2.8 (3H, m), 3.34 and 3.64, 3.48 and 3.59 (together 2H, 2ABq, J 18.9, 18.4 Hz), 4.08 (3H, s), 5.10, 5.11 (together 1H, 2d, J 4.9 Hz), 5.35 (2H, bs), 5.5-5.95 (3H, m), 6.00, 6.10 (together 1H, 2dd, J 9, 4.9 Hz), 6.85, 6.87 (together 1H, 2s), 7.52, 7.54 (together 1H, 2d, J 9 Hz); [mass spectrum: +ve ion (3-nitrobenzyl alcohol-sodium acetate) MH+(582) MNa+(604)].
